﻿
#flash_menu{float:right;}
.top_font{text-align:right;line-height:25px;padding-top:5px;}
.top_font2{text-align:right;line-height:25px;padding-top:0px;}
.top_font a{margin:0 1px;}
.m_top{margin-top:8px;}
#logo{text-align:left;padding-top:10px;}

.site_right{background:url(bg.jpg) no-repeat;width:175px;height:160px;float:right;;color:#fff;padding:0 5px;padding-top:43px;}<!-- height:320px; -->
.home_left{background:url(products_titte.gif) no-repeat;width:188px;height:160px;float:left;;color:#fff;padding:0 5px;padding-top:43px;}<!-- height:320px; -->
.class_list{height:300px;overflow:hidden;line-height:22px;text-align:left;padding-left:10px;}<!-- border-bottom:1px solid #ccc; -->
.class_list a:link,.class_list a:visited{color:#999}

.products_list{width:455px;}
.new_prod{width:300px;padding-bottom:8px;}
.products_list li{float:left;width:110px;text-align:center;margin-left:3px;padding-top:5px;}
.products_list li p{padding-top:5px;font-size:13px;font-weight:bold;}
.title{background:#E6E3E3;line-height:25px;margin-bottom:8px;}
.title_blue{background:url(tittle_bluebg.gif);line-height:28px;margin-bottom:8px;float:left;color:#fff}
.title_blue_l{background:url(tittle_blue01.gif);line-height:28px;width:13px;margin-bottom:8px;float:left;}
.title_blue_r{background:url(tittle_blue02.gif);line-height:28px;width:16px;margin-bottom:8px;float:left;}
.title b{display:block;background:url(title_bg.jpg) no-repeat left;padding-left:35px;font-size:14px;}
.scroll_three { width:740px; height:55px; overflow:hidden;}
.scroll_three li a { padding:2px; border:1px solid #d7d7d7;  }
.scroll_three li {display:inline-block;float:left;}



.prod_class{line-height:18px;}

.flash_left{float:left;}

#footer{background:url(footer.jpg) no-repeat top;padding-top:8px;}
#jsweb8_cn_left img{margin:0 3px;}




#scrollDiv{height:120px;overflow:hidden;}
#scrollDiv li{height:115px;}


/******************************************/
.class_menu{border:5px solid #DBD7D6;margin-bottom:8px;}
.class_menu li{padding:5px 0;float:left;line-height:15px;margin-left:10px;}
.class_menu b{float:left;;width:5px;height:13px;background:#ccc;margin:0 5px;}
.class_menu a:hover b{background:red;}

.f_right{float:right;}
.f_left{float:left;}
.product,.product_display,.news_display,.news{width:735px;border:1px solid #c6c6c6;border-width:0 1px;}
.product li{float:left;width:42%;line-height:20px;margin:0 10px;padding:8px 0;border-top:2px solid #eee;margin-bottom:8px;}
.product li img{}
.product a:link,.product a:visited{color:#0033ff},.product a:hover{color:#FDB602;}
.product_bian{background:url(bian.gif) repeat-y left;}

.list_img{float:left;width:150px;height:115px;margin-right:5px;}
.product li b{line-height:30px;}

.neiye{background:url(bian.gif) repeat-y left;padding-left:25px;width:740px;margin:0 auto;margin-bottom:8px;}
.neiye2{padding-left:25px;width:1000px;margin:0 auto;margin-bottom:8px;}
.neiye3{width:1000px;background:#ffffff;margin:0 auto;}

.type_list{width:28%;}
.type_list li{background:#F7F7F7;line-height:25px;border-bottom:1px solid #fff;width:280px;}
.type_list li span{background:#EEEEEE;padding:3px;border-right:1px solid #fff;width:100px;text-align:right;float:left;}

#ch_img{padding:10px;height:250px;width:320px;text-align:center;overflow:hidden; float:left}
#bi_img{padding-top:10px;}
#bi_img img{margin:0 5px;border:0px solid #ccc;}
.t_title{font-size:14px;font-weight:bold;line-height:25px;}
.pic_list{width:700px;overflow:hidden;padding-left:10px;}//width:400px;padding-left:10px;float:left;
.pic_top{border-bottom:1px solid #ccc;margin:10px;padding:10px 0;}
.type{float:left;}
.cont_prod{padding:10px;}

.news ul{margin:0 auto;width:90%;}
.news li{line-height:35px;border-bottoM:1px dashed #ccc;background:url(li_bg.jpg) no-repeat left;padding-left:15px;}
.news li a{display:block;}
.news li span{float:right;}
.t_title_news{text-align:center;font-size:17px;font-weight:bold;}
.info{line-height:23px;padding:15px}

.pages {text-align:center;border-top:1px dashed #ccc;padding-top:5px;}
.pages a{margin:0 5px;}



.b_left{float:left;width:240px;  }
.b_left li a:link,.b_left li a:visited{color:#666666;}
.b_left li a:hover{color:red;}
.b_left h2{font-size:18px;color:#666666;font-weight:bold;text-align:left;margin-bottom:25px;margin-top:-5px}
.b_left li {font-size:14px;border-bottom:0px solid #E2E1DF;line-height:30px;padding-left:10px;}

.b_right{float:right}
.b_right2{position: relative; top: 0px; right: 5px; }
.b_right3{float:left;width:736px;}

.class_left{width:200px;position: relative; top: 20px; left: 25px; overflow:hidden;padding:15px}

.pagelist{margin:0 auto;width:auto;word-wrap:normal}

.p_bottom{padding-bottom:8px;}


.QQbox{ z-index:99; width: 155px; right: 0; top: 40px; position: absolute;}
.QQbox .press{float: right; width: 82px; height:111px; background:url(msg.jpg) no-repeat;text-indent : 16px;}
.QQbox .Qlist{ left: 0; width: 155px; background: url(qq_listbg.gif) repeat-y -166px 0;  position: absolute;}
.QQbox .Qlist .t,
.QQbox .Qlist .b{ float: left; height: 6px; width: 158px; font-size: 1px; }
.QQbox .Qlist .t{ background: url(qq_listbg.gif) no-repeat left; }
.QQbox .Qlist .b{ background: url(hqq_listbg.gif) no-repeat right; }
.QQbox .Qlist .con{ background: #fff; width: 80%; margin: 0 auto; }
.QQbox .Qlist .con h2{ height: 22px; font: bold 12px/22px "宋体"; background: url(qq_listbg.gif) repeat-y -166px 0; border: 1px solid #2D4A8C; text-align: center; color:#fff;}
.QQbox .Qlist .con ul{  }
.QQbox .Qlist .con ul li{  padding: 5px 0 0 8px;height: 20px; background: #e8e8e8;}
.QQbox .Qlist .con ul li.odd{ background: #fff; }

.tleft{text-align:right;}
.p_table td{height:30px;line-height:30px}
.p_table2 td{height:30px;line-height:30px}
.bg1{background:#F6F6F6}
.bg2{background:#FFF7F0}
.bgh{background:#FFFFFF}
table { 
table-layout: fixed;
word-wrap:break-word;
}
div { 
word-wrap:break-word;
}
.links a{margin:0 5px;}
.link_list li{float:left;}
.keywords{color:#ccc;text-align:center}
.keywords a:link,.keywords a:visited{color:#ccc}

.keywords2{color:#CCCCCC;text-align:center}
.keywords2 a:link,.keywords2 a:visited{color:#CCCCCC}

.bottom_nav{color:#fff;}
.bottom_nav a:link,.bottom_nav a:visited{color:#fff}

.bottom_nav2{color:#cccccc; font-size:16px;text-align:left;}
.bottom_nav2 a:link,.bottom_nav2 a:visited{color:#cccccc}

.navbg{background:url(hometop_bg1.jpg) repeat-y;width:1000px;height:60px;}

.sub2nav{height:15px;width:500px;border-bottom:2px dashed #CCCCCC;padding-top:10px;padding-bottom:10px;font-family: "Arial Black"}

body { background: #33210b; }

.hiddentext{color: #33210b;font-size: xx-small;}


